- Abstract : A schematic presentation for the valence transition from 3+ to 2+ of Eu in Ca2(1+ x ) La8(1− x ) (SiO4 )6− x (PO4 ) x O2 :Eu (0 ≤ x ≤ 6) based on the XANES spectroscopy analysis. Abstract : By cosubstituting [Ca 2+ –P 5+ ] for [La 3+ –Si 4+ ] in the Eu-doped Ca(2→8) La(8→2) (SiO4 )6− x (PO4 ) x O2 (0 ≤ x ≤ 6) system, Eu 3+ ions are controllably and gradually transformed to Eu 2+ . Thus, the emission colors consecutively changed from red to blue/green light. Furthermore, excellent warm-white lights with the low correlated color temperature (CCT) range of 3500–3800 K and a high color rendering index ( R a ) (88.4–93.2) have been achieved by mixing the as-prepared phosphors at different cation cosubstitution ratios.
